## Data stores

Vendored third-party fonts for the Tindervale report builder are stored as blobs, not files. License metadata sits alongside each blob so the scanner can verify terms per font. No CDN fetches at runtime; everything resolves from the font table. For review, query license rows directly using the connection string below.

replica DSN, kajep-yahag: mssql://praok_svc:iF@db-8d68.plorvaio.local:5432/eliion

INTERNAL MEMO — Sales Leads

Following the October stock audit at the Marrow Point distribution centre, we are recording a write-down on the remaining Calderis V2 handset inventory. Obsolescence after the V3 launch, combined with moisture damage in bay C, accounts for roughly eighty percent of the adjustment. Please update forecasts to exclude V2 units from Q1 targets and redirect bundle offers toward the Calderis Lite line. The financial rationale and next steps are set out below.

confidential, yawif-fadup: The southern region missed its Eliius quota by 61.1 percent last quarter. Istixax Freight plans to raise the Jorwyn list price by 65.7 percent in October. The board signed off on a budget of $445.3 million for Project Ulaox. The renewal with Briathax Partners closes at $41.0 million a year, 49.9 percent below the last contract.

**Q: How do I add a new validator to the Sievekit plugin system?**

A: Validators live as standalone plugins implementing the `Check` interface. Register yours in the manifest, pin its version, and run the conformance suite before opening a merge request. Do not bypass the manifest — dynamically loaded validators are rejected at startup. Sample plugins are in the `examples` directory of the Sievekit repo. Access to the plugin registry requires contractor credentials, which take a day to provision. To request access, write to the address below.

escalation mailbox, hadug-bajog: sormir@norvalabs.internal